KIMBERLEY HILL
President & Developer
Kim founded Hill-Johnson & Weinstein in 2014 to focus on development opportunities in the single family housing sector. Kim draws on almost three decades of experience in business, including management, construction, operations, and growth and development. She has managed portfolios valued at $200M+ She is the first Black Female Developer in the state of Tennessee.

JOHN FEEHAN
Chief Financial Officer
Jack has over 25 years of experience in the financial underwriting of over 59,000 multifamily units throughout the United States. He has played a vital role in developing over $6 Billion in new multifamily construction projects.
Mr. Feehan holds a B.S. from the United States Naval Academy and an M.B.A from Harvard Business School. He is a licensed California Real Estate Broker, 00675347, and a retired Commander from the United States Naval Reserves

FASIL KEBEDE
General Contractor
Since founding the Company in 2008 that was eventually renamed Beruk Construction, Inc. (“BCI”), Fasil Kebede has been intimately involved with the start-up and continued growth and development of Beruk Construction, Inc. (“Beruk”). BCI, which is a licensed General Contractor in both Tennessee and Mississippi, has distinguished itself from other contractors by locating real estate projects in overlooked areas and then offering unique development and building designs. BCI & HJW has teamed up to complete projects that include new construction, renovation and additions for the following types of properties:
Convenience stores, Church and Mosque projects, Daycare properties, Neighborhood shopping centers, Family Dollar locations, Subway buildouts, Residential lot development and single-family home sales

JOSEPH ALRIDGE, ESQ
General Counsel
Mr. Aldridge has extensive experience in local opinions, real estate lease reviews, traditional and non-traditional commercial banking transactions, and non-performing debt workouts.
Mr. Aldridge’s has worked for both public and small businesses in the process of capital asset (or business) acquisitions, commercial banks, and hospitality interests with assets from 10 million to greater than one billion.
In addition, Mr. Aldridge is of counsel to the firm of HPL Yamalova Plewka JLT, Jumeirah Lakes Towers Freezone, Dubai, United Arab Emirates, for which he provides advice on real estate purchase workouts, and restructure of failed off plan purchases.
